  • The Nerve Impulse Arc

    Think about a baby reaching out to the touch a brightly coloured flame. Sensory receptors within the fingertips detect the extraordinary warmth, triggering a nerve impulse that races in the direction of the spinal wire. This sign doesn’t ascend to the mind for deliberation. As a substitute, it synapses straight onto motor neurons, which, in flip, command the muscle groups of the arm to contract, pulling the hand away from the supply of hazard. This speedy sequence represents the essence of the sensory-motor arc, a elementary unit of reflexive motion. The sensory enter straight triggers the motor output, bypassing acutely aware thought and minimizing potential hurt.

  • Blood Strain Management and Baroreceptor Reflexes

    Think about a seasoned pilot executing a high-G maneuver. The sudden acceleration causes a brief drop in blood strain, threatening to deprive the mind of oxygen. Fortuitously, specialised receptors, referred to as baroreceptors, sense this strain change and set off a collection of compensatory reflexes. The center price will increase, blood vessels constrict, and blood strain surges again in the direction of regular, guaranteeing the pilot maintains consciousness and management of the plane. These speedy, unconscious actions safeguard cerebral perfusion, stopping catastrophic lack of consciousness, proving that baroreceptor responses are vital to homeostatic motion.
